1. The Layout of the Over-Sized Snake-Ladder Game

The researcher adapted the layout of the commercial Snake-Ladder game. The researcher only modified the size and the number of paths in the game based on several suggestions from the experts. Because the over-sized Snake-Ladder game also designed to employ the motorist skills of the students, the researcher designed a huge board. The researcher made 3 x 4 meters for the board of the over-sized Snake-Ladder game. Therefore, the students should use their motor skills to jump from one path to the other paths. The following picture was the layout of the over-sized Snake- Ladder game. Figure 4.3 The Layout of the Over-Sized Snake-Ladder Game The finish path The start path 70 Additionally, the researcher still used some supporting tools to play the over-sized Snake-Ladder game. They were the dice and the fruits flashcard. The following pictures were the supporting tools of the designed game. Figure 4.4 The Pictures of Supporting Tools Moreover, the researcher put the pictures of the snakes and the ladders as the commercial game had. Those snakes and the ladders could be used to express the students’ emotion such as sadness and happiness. The following picture was the illustration of the snakes and the ladders inside of the designed game. Figure 4.5 The Picture of Snake and Ladder 71 The example of sign systems The researcher also added several sign systems inside of the game. The additional sign systems were derived from the suggestions of English teacher of TK Kanisius Kotabaru,Yogyakarta. The following picture was several sign systems inside of the game. Figure 4.6 The Illustration of Sign Systems The researcher also designed the over-sized Snake-Ladder game with colorful pictures. It could raise the kindergarten students’ enthusiasm in learning and challenge their foresight and their imagination Campbell et al, 1996.

2. The Content of the Over-Sized Snake-Ladder Game

According to Lee 1986, a Snake-Ladder game should provide a picture of the snakes and the ladders. The snake is to go down, while the ladder is to go up p. 166. In this study, the researcher provided several pictures of the snake and 72 The example of fruits’ pictures the ladder inside of the board. The researcher also added several pictures of fruits to describe the theme such as banana, papaya, grape, orange, and apple. All the pictures inside the game were attractive, colorful, and interesting for children. The following picture was the part of the over-sized Snake-Ladder game. Figure 4.7 The Illustration of Names of the Fruits Moreover, the researcher also used basic colors as the content of the over- sized Snake-Ladder game. The researcher asked the students to pronounce names of colors to review the material about colors. It was assumed that the students had got material about colors before they learnt about names of fruits. The following picture was names of the colors.
